Phomopsis-svampe kan som endofytiske svampe i planter producere en bred vifte af aktive sekund\u00e6re metabolitter, herunder \u03b1-pyranon, terpener, alkaloider og celleafslappende midler. Disse forbindelser udviser ikke kun farmakologiske aktiviteter s\u00e5som svampedr\u00e6bende, antitumor, neurobeskyttende og \u03b1-glucosidaseh\u00e6mmende, men kan ogs\u00e5 bruges som cellev\u00e6kstregulatorer. Vores forskningsgruppe fik en endofytisk svamp Phomopsis prunorum (F4-3) fra bladene p\u00e5 Camellia sinensis-planter i Shennongjia-omr\u00e5det i den tidlige fase. Efter fermentering og dyrkning i lille skala viste det sig, at risfermenteringsprodukterne havde et rigt udvalg af strukturelle typer. Tidligere forskning i denne svamp P Nye myrra-sesquiterpener og isocoumariner er blevet opdaget i prunorum (F4-3), der viser god aktivitet mod landbrugspatogene bakterier. Dette studie unders\u00f8ger yderligere svampen P Der blev udf\u00f8rt forskning i risfermenteringsprodukterne fra prunorum (F4-3), og den biologiske aktivitet af de isolerede sekund\u00e6re metabolitter blev evalueret for at opdage forbindelser med nye strukturelle typer og betydelige farmakologiske aktiviteter.<\/p>\n<p>I denne unders\u00f8gelse blev silikagels\u00f8jlekromatografi, gels\u00f8jlekromatografi og semiforberedende HPLC brugt til at adskille P Seks sekund\u00e6re metabolitter blev isoleret fra prunorum (F4-3), herunder to nye \u03b1 - pyranonforbindelser og to kendte dibenzo \u03b1 - pyranonforbindelser, en isocoumarinforbindelse og en alkaloidforbindelse. Sidek\u00e6destrukturerne i \u03b1-pyranonforbindelserne 1 og 2 indeholder begge tilst\u00f8dende dihydroxyfragmenter, og forbindelserne 4-6 blev isoleret for f\u00f8rste gang fra denne svampesl\u00e6gt. Evaluering af den farmakologiske aktivitet viste, at kun forbindelse 3 havde moderat alfa-glucosidaseh\u00e6mmende aktivitet, mens forbindelserne 1-6 ikke viste nogen signifikant antibakteriel aktivitet. If\u00f8lge litteraturrapporter udviser forbindelse 3 ogs\u00e5 en vis cytotoksisk aktivitet og DPPH-radikalopfangningsaktivitet (IC50 p\u00e5 46,5 \u03bc M) og har svag antibakteriel aktivitet mod forskellige plantepatogener. Denne unders\u00f8gelse isolerede ikke forbindelser med kemiske sammens\u00e6tningsstrukturer, der ligner dem fra Camellia sinensis. Det kan skyldes, at mange genklynger, der er relateret til synteseveje for sekund\u00e6re metabolitter, er d\u00e6mpet under normale laboratoriekulturforhold. I fremtiden vil man fors\u00f8ge at fremkalde udtrykket af tavse gener i bakteriestammer ved at \u00e6ndre typen af dyrkningsmedium eller tils\u00e6tte kemiske epigenetiske modifikatorer til dyrkningsmediet for at \u00f8ge mangfoldigheden af sekund\u00e6re metabolitstrukturer og forbedre sandsynligheden for at opdage nye og aktive forbindelser.<\/p>","protected":false},"excerpt":{"rendered":"<p>Unders\u00f8gelse af sekund\u00e6re metabolitter og \u03b1-glukosidaseh\u00e6mmende aktivitet af endofytisk svamp Phomopsis prunorum i Camellia sinensis Phomopsis-svampe er en almindelig type plantepatogen, der kan for\u00e5rsage alvorlige sygdomme i forskellige afgr\u00f8der; I mellemtiden er nogle arter inden for denne sl\u00e6gt ogs\u00e5 vigtige endofytiske svampe, der er bredt til stede i de fleste planter i naturen.
